Is the emergency room staff generally friendly and professional?
Multiple customers describe the staff as excellent, super friendly, and professional, noting that they provided calm and compassionate care during stressful situations, including after a motorcycle accident and during surgery. Guests often mention the kindness and patience of doctors, nurses, and support staff, and appreciate the extra comforts provided in patient rooms.
Source: 5 of 8 reviews • Confidence: high (explicit mention)
Are there concerns about billing practices at the emergency room?
Several reviewers report issues with billing, stating that they received unexpectedly high charges despite brief visits and minimal treatment. One reviewer mentioned a $7,000 insurance bill plus a $1,000 out-of-pocket charge after a short consultation and CT scan, suggesting the hospital may prioritize revenue over patient care.
